Grower/finisherA mycotoxin produced by moulds such as Aspergillus fumigatus. It causes cell death and is a strong immunosuppressant when ingested by animals. If an animal is exposed to the mycotoxin for a long period of time, its toxicity will be accelerated. Cattle with mastitis that are unable to be treated may be the due to ingestion of gliotoxin.

FodderFungi that invade the crop while it is still in the field (pre-harvest). These fungi include the Fusarium species and some Aspergillus species. They generally require higher moisture levels than storage fungi.
Field fungiA toxic reaction in the body of animals that have ingested tall fescue infected with endophytes that produce the toxin ergovaline. Tall fescue is a major forage grass found in America in central and south-eastern states. In cattle signs of fescue toxicosis include low conception rates, low milk production, reduced weight gain, hyperthermia in the summer.
